Drive till you qualify: an alternative view of housing affordability

Using census data and vehicle purchase and running cost data, a model is developed which analyses the proportion of household income devoted to housing and transport for specific locations within the metropolitan areas of Adelaide.

The importance of house size in the pursuit of low carbon housing

This paper investigated the relationship between house size, star ratings and renewable energy systems to identify a range of affordable low carbon housing scenarios for the Australian market, specifically focusing on Zero (net) Energy Housing (ZEH) for Melbourne, Victoria.

Future policy directions for zero emission housing in Australia: implications from an international review and comparison

This paper analyses current new housing energy performance policies from Australia, the EU and USA against a set of socio-technical transitions principles presented within a zero emission housing framework.
